Introduction and Unboxing
Launched by the Chinese Company Gionee in the Indian market,The GPad G2,is a 5.3” phablet with some Amazing specs like a Quad Core 1.2GHz MediaTek processor,1 Gigabyte of RAM and a 240 PPi qHD display For A Very Budget price of INR 13,990.The Phone runs on 2 SIM cards.One is Micro-SIM with 3G support and the other is a normal SIM.This phone is a competitor to the Micromax Canvas Doodle as well as the Titanium S5.The Box of the Phone is pretty simplistic.You get a free flip cover with the phone.Other than the that,We have the Phone itself,2 screen protectors,USB Wall charger,Micro USB to USB cable,Standard earphones,the massive 3000mAh Battery and micro-sim ejector tool.You also have a bit of paperwork.

Design and Build Quality
*i.imgur.com/e3N2VLPl.png
The design is simplistic with all plastic construction and with around 9.9 mm thickness,this is really one of the thinnest phablets in the Indian market.On the front are some sensors,a speakerphone and 2mp camera along with the 3 capacitive buttons and a microphone at the bottom.On the sides are the volume rockers(Right hand Side) and a power button(Left hand side) which is very oddly placed.On the top is the 3.5mm headphone jack and the bottom has the micro USB port for syncing and charging.The Back has an 8 mp camera which not the best you can get but we will talk about it later.On the bottom right is the speakerphone which is fairly loud but can be annoying at full volumes.The Back is removable and the back cover is made up of a glossy plastic.Inside we have the 3000mAh Battery,2 sim slots and a 16GB SD card included.

Overall,The Build quality of this phone is pretty decent for the price.The Glossy plastic can be a fingerprint magnet but it isn't visible much on the white version.The provided flip cover is a nice addition and it can wake/sleep the screen too.

Hardware Performance,Benchmarks and Gaming
The GPad G2 runs on a 1.2GHz Quad Core Mediatek Chip and a 1GB RAM.The GPU is PowerVR SGX544MP.The Benchmark scores were pretty high for a phone of this range but not comparable to the quad core devices from samsung or sony.You can see the different scores of benchmarks that i ran in the pictures below

The phone does a great job in running Android and its features.The multitasking works flawlessly and even after loading a lot of apps,the phone doesnt slow down.With such nice specs,the software runs very smooth and tasks like Browsing,Mailing etc very snappy with almost no lag.I could load up heavy websites such as the verge and it could handle the zoom in zoom out easily and it rendered the page very well.Thanks to the large display,the content looks very nice.Even heavy apps like Google Earth which has a lot of 3d rendering,worked well which ironically lag on my Xperia S.Overall,the Hardware does a great job in running the device.The performance of the phone is great and there's no noticeable lag.But Yes,there might be little lag at rare times but let's just call it the classic Android Stuttering.

Gaming was also a breeze on this phone.I downloaded various famous titles such as NFS Most Wanted,Modern Combat 4,RipTide GP,Dead trigger and temple run 2 and all ran really well.I was very much impressed by the performance on Modern Combat 4.The Game looked great.I even played Temple Run 2 by changing the Graphic Settings to high and it worked nicely.The only Games that lagged were Asphalt 7 and Gangster vegas but I guess Gangster vegas had some issues with its release version on many devices

Software
*i.imgur.com/yyy751Cl.jpg
Out of the Box we are greeted with Android 4.1.2 and all its great features.Gionee has its custom lanuncher with various themes and widgets to choose from.I was not a big fan of this launcher as the themes and widgets caused a little lag while navigating through the homescreen and the animations were slow too.So to get a proper performance,I loaded up Nova Launcher along with HD widgets and an icon pack and the phone was as snappy as it could get.Gionee has tweaked the software a bit and has added toggles in the Notification center which is very useful.You also get notifications on your lockscreen circle.Gionee GPad G2 also supports OTA or Over The Air Updates.Overall,The software is snappy and quick.All the Jellybean 4.1 features are present like Google Now & Project Butter

Camera
*i.imgur.com/dVr5XgCl.jpg
One of the major issues with the “Budget” smartphones is the camera;And in the Gpad G2 too,i wasnt impressed much.The Camera App has a simple interface.You can set various image properties and resolutions.The Max photo output is 8 megapixels and video is 720p.The video camera has tap to focus functionality which is nice.The Outdoor Performance of the Camera was between Medium to Good but the Indoor Performance was rather average.Pictures looked a bit grainy indoors and lacked sharpness.The Camera Test is also in the Review Video if you're interested in learning more about the Camera.Other than that,One issue I had was that,the pictures indoors when taken from a third party app like instagram or camera 360,were dull but the stock camera took them right.But maybe,this might be the issue with my unit.So,If you are not a big photography fan or you rather use your phone only outdoors,then you won't have an issue with it.
Screen Quality and Media Consumption
*i.imgur.com/r71w085l.jpg
The 5.3 inch screen is nice.Viewing angles are really good and colours look vivid and nice.With 960x540 resolution the display only has 241 PPI which is good but not that appealing to me as my phone has a 341 PPI display.But You do get more screen real estate on this phone and movie watching would be treat for you.The display is very much reflective which makes it hard to use even with full brightness outdoors.Typing is amazing on this phone.With such a big screen.You can type easily and quickly without making any mistakes.
Regarding the Media Consumption,the large screen makes video watching a treat.Movies played perfectly without any lag but when I played some heavy files which are like 3 to 4GB in size,they did lag(But it is expected as these are very heavy files).The Mono speaker is loud enough but at full volumes it can turn annoying.Also,one thing I noticed is that the music output through headphones was flat because the phone's stock player doesn't have a tunable equaliser.
Battery Life
*i.imgur.com/sEDJbRXl.png
The Battery life was very Good on this Phone.I was able to pull out a day completely.I had the brightness turned up to 100%,did a bit of browsing,moderate to high gaming and data downloading.I was running dual sims with one on HSPA+ 3G.I could easily pull out a day with Medium to Heavy Usage.Gionee also has some battery saving features but I never used them.If you are in search of a phone with decent battery life,the Gpad G2 is not going to disappoint you
The call quality was nice and clear and the dual sims worked prefectly fine.
